HARRIS COUNTY, TX– On April 27, deputies with Pct. 4 Constable Mark Herman’s Office responded to the Gringo’s Mexican Restaurant located in the 19300 block of the North Freeway in reference to a theft. Upon deputies arriving, they learned an employee, identified as James Green Jr., had been stealing money.
Investigation revealed that from March 2023 to April 2023, he had been writing his own monetary tips on receipts from multiple customers, totaling over $3,499.00.
As deputies attempted to detain him, he ran out of the business and fled on foot. After a brief foot pursuit, he was located and apprehended.
The Vice President of operations refunded customers for the unauthorized tip amounts.
“James Green Jr. was arrested and booked into the Harris County Jail, charged with Aggregate Theft and Evading Arrest. His total bond was set at $5,100.00 out of the 182nd District Court and County Court 15,” Constable Mark Herman said.
